Six years ago, I sat quietly on my living room floor furiously sifting through a box of old negatives and prints. Squinting at the hundreds of blurred, rejected images, I recalled how unsure I was about my ability and the ultimate decision to give up photography all together. The photos just weren't sharp enough, cool enough, worthy of posting on some ridiculous website. But in the days after my father's funeral, I found myself sitting on that cold floor clinging to every over exposed shot, every "mistake", all priceless moments with my dad caught at the end of my modest $20 camera.

"Photography helps people to see." - Berenice Abbott

 

In the years that followed, I found courage. I plyed my trade. With the support of an encouraging friend, I fell in love all over again. I shoot because I have to. I see you as you are and love you anyway. I fill the box.
